Output ed5a98dcebb7d624f432dcfa2e2ac8f6b09acd7279b93bda16f1e28c21099582:43

value
680524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0d8f8b424675e98ca24b1d45e5ac940b087f93c OP_EQUAL
address
3PeW22XLvBDAvw8v1FgvZEhb7PcEB5TM3j
transaction
ed5a98dcebb7d624f432dcfa2e2ac8f6b09acd7279b93bda16f1e28c21099582
spent
true